怎么在div中设置鼠标滑过变超链接
- html
- 1天前
- 4热度
- 0评论
要在div中设置鼠标滑过时变成超链接,可以通过
CSS为div添加:hover伪类选择器,并使用cursor: pointer;
使得鼠标指针在滑过时变成手指形状。然后,可以使用text-decoration: underline;为文本添加下划线,表示它是可点击的。当然,实际上这只是一个div,要变成真正的超链接,你需要添加点击事件处理器,使用JavaScript来处理点击后的行为(通常是导航到另一个页面)。
以下是实现这一功能的示例代码:
HTML:
<div class="link" id="myLink">这是一个可点击的div</div>
.link {
cursor: pointer;
text-decoration: underline;
color: blue;
}
.link:hover {
color: red;
}
document.getElementById('myLink').onclick = function() {
window.location.href = 'https://www.example.com';
};
当用户将鼠标悬停在div上时,文本颜色会变成红色,并且在点击时会导航到'https://www.example.com'。